RIP Dave Valentin
A well known sideman with McCoy Tyner and Tito Puente, latin-jazz flautist Dave Valentin, whose high profile career highlights also included winning a Grammy with the Caribbean Jazz Project, has died aged 64 in his native Bronx. NY Times
